About

Sarah Evans is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ine and General Health Professions. According to data from OpenAlex, Sarah Evans has authored 9 papers receiving a total of 158 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 3 papers in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ine and 2 papers in General Health Professions. Recurrent topics in Sarah Evans’s work include Respiratory Support and Mechanisms (4 papers), COVID-19 Clinical Research Studies (2 papers) and Long-Term Effects of COVID-19 (2 papers). Sarah Evans is often cited by papers focused on Respiratory Support and Mechanisms (4 papers), COVID-19 Clinical Research Studies (2 papers) and Long-Term Effects of COVID-19 (2 papers). Sarah Evans coll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Canada and Australia. Sarah Evans's co-authors include Colin Hamilton, Nick Neave, Delia Wakelin, Brent Snook, Kirk Luther, Joseph Eastwood, Cynthia Chan, Nayia Petousi, Patrick Elder and Lawrence Cavedon and has published in prestigious journals such as Physiology & Behavior, BMC Geriatrics and Journal of Palliative Care.
